Output 314304e069d20415639f6c57e8312fcf3ba53b3f975afec9e1003bb28709969b:19

value
35647
script pubkey
OP_0 OP_PUSHBYTES_20 56f0f354143486585a45509c5c3c013ed7ad61bf
address
bc1q2mc0x4q5xjr9skj92zw9c0qp8mt66cdlv4h6jc
transaction
314304e069d20415639f6c57e8312fcf3ba53b3f975afec9e1003bb28709969b
spent
true